Mark Gesswein Killed in Motorcycle Crash Following Alleged Pursuit in Rockford, Illinois
On the morning of September 5, 2025, a fatal motorcycle crash occurred in Rockford, Illinois, resulting in the death of 45-year-old Mark Gesswein. According to the Winnebago County Sheriff’s Office, the incident took place around 9:30 a.m. in the 100 block of Monroe Street, near Ingersoll Golf Course. Upon arrival, authorities found Gesswein deceased at the scene.
Investigators determined that Gesswein was being pursued by 40-year-old Jose E. Olivencia III, who had reported two of his motorcycles stolen earlier that day. Olivencia allegedly recognized one of the stolen motorcycles being driven by Gesswein and began chasing him in a red minivan. During the pursuit, Olivencia is reported to have attempted to force Gesswein off the road, causing the crash. Olivencia has since been charged with First Degree Murder. The Winnebago County Major Crash Assistance Team is continuing its investigation.
